  • SummaryCaption: "Thirty years service--Honoring two trustees of the Williamsburg Settlement for 30 years of service to underprivileged children, Mrs. Cecile Rubin, president of the settlement (center), watches as Mrs. Esther Haber (left) and Mrs. Gertrude Kleinfeld cut cakes presented at luncheon in their honor at the Columbus Club, 1 Prospect Park West. The settlement is located at 17 Montrose Ave."
